Priority: High — for the release manager's attention.

The credential used by the Thornbay pre-warmer service expired overnight, so our serverless handlers are no longer being kept warm. Every invocation since 02:00 has incurred a full cold start, pushing p95 latency well past our target. The function code itself is fine; only the pre-warmer's authentication to the scheduling service is affected.

A replacement credential has been issued and validated in staging. Please deploy it before the next release window. The new key is below.

app token of yahif-fahap = vxb3-3pr

Welcome! The import wizard reads all runtime configuration from `.env`, loaded once at startup — restarts are required after any change.

Core variables: `IMPORT_MAX_ROWS` (default 50000) guards against runaway uploads; `IMPORT_DELIMITER_AUTO` enables delimiter sniffing; `IMPORT_TMP_DIR` must be writable by the worker user. Header mapping presets live in the database, not the env.

One more thing before you can run the wizard locally: it signs staged-import callbacks with a secret, which is set on the line that follows.

vault entry, yahif-yajep: COURIER_KEY29=b802bdf8034096b65a51c6ba5abe2

## Releases

Quick notes for support folks shipping VaultSpin, our secrets-rotation utility. Releases cut every other Thursday; hotfixes anytime via `spin release --hotfix`. Changelog lives in `CHANGES.md` — keep it honest, customers read it. After the build passes smoke tests on the Kestrel ring, publish to the internal registry. The registry refuses unsigned uploads, full stop. Sign your upload with the key below.

rollout seal: bky4_x7Gc

**Ticket RB-1142 — SpokeShift vault locked**

The SpokeShift rebalancing tool can't read dock capacity configs; its secrets vault locked after three bad unseal attempts during the Harwick depot migration. Rebalancing runs are paused. Do not retry unseal blindly — each failure extends the lockout. Use the standby recovery console on the coordinator node instead. It will prompt once for the recovery passphrase, recorded below.

vault phrase of bagaf-kajeg = jorath-feniel-briir-siliel-ralix